Manpur is a Rural village located in Pipariya, Kabeerdham, Chhattisgarh.
The total population of Manpur is 262.
Manpur village comprises 65 households.
The literacy rate in Manpur is 51.7%. Among the literate population of 109, there are 73 literate males and 36 literate females.
In Manpur, there are 131 males and 131 females, with a sex ratio of 1000 females per 1000 males.
There are 51 children (19.5% of population), comprising 25 boys and 26 girls.
The total number of workers in Manpur is 134, with 60 main workers and 74 marginal workers.
In Manpur, there are 131 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(64 males, 67 females) and 52 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(28 males, 24 females).
Manpur is located in Chhattisgarh state, Kabeerdham district, and falls under Pipariya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 439061 and LGD code is 439061.
